Alvarez Selected by Sounders in MLS SuperDraft

SEATTLE - Senior defender Demian Alvarez was selected in the 2nd round of the 2025 MLS SuperDraft by the Seattle Sounders on Friday, as announced by Major League Soccer and the Seattle Sounders. He becomes the fifth Redhawk to be selected by the hometown Sounders.

"We are thrilled for Demian to get drafted by the Seattle Sounders and are excited for this next chapter in his playing career," said head coach Nate Daligcon. "Over the past two years he has been an integral part of the team's success, and we are excited to watch his development at the professional level."

Alvarez, a native of Chico, Calif., had a standout final season with the Redhawks in 2024. Not only did he help lead the team to its 10th Western Athletic Conference (WAC) title, but he was also named the conference's Defender of the Year and was named the Most Outstanding Player at the conclusion of the WAC tournament. He also received national attention, being announced as a selection to the United Soccer Coaches All-Far West Region First Team.

In two seasons with the program, he started and played in 38 games while registering two goals and assisting on another. Where the center back shined was defensively, guiding a stingy Seattle U back line to 24 wins and two NCAA tournament appearances over the two-year span. 

He joins Kyle Bjornethun (2017), Alex Roldan (2018), Julian Avila-Good (2020), and Hal Uderitz (2022) as players to be drafted by the Seattle Sounders from the Redhawk program, with Roldan still being an active player for the club. He is also the eighth player selected in the SuperDraft since 2017.
